Rohr Receives Good News As Ebuehi Circles Date On His Calendar For Comeback
Published: April 23, 2018
Super Eagles coach Gernot Rohr has received good news from Dutch Eredivisie outfit ADO Den Haag about the condition of Tyronne Ebuehi.
The Nigeria international has been battling to overcome an injury since March 10, which has curtailed his appearances to two games from a possible five.
The injury update released by ADO Den Haag on Monday morning confirmed that Ebuehi is ready for a comeback and the defender was videoed being put through his paces by an unnamed coaching staff.
Though the 22-year-old did not train with the rest of his teammates, he is expected to join the group in the coming days, ahead of Sunday's league match against PSV Eindhoven at Cars Jeans Stadion.
Ebuehi needs to play two more games in the league before surpassing his highest number of appearances for a season (29) which he set in the 2016-2017 campaign.
It is a foregone conclusion that he will be named to Nigeria's 35-man provisional roster for the World Cup when it is announced next month, barring any new developments.
